Zapya for Android connect to share screen Once both phones are connected, you should see the avatars and phone names at the top left corner on both your iPhone and Android mobile. Wait for it to find your Android phone, then tap on your Android device name to connect them. On your iPhone, tap on the the Transfer button at the bottom middle on its home screen to open the Radar search and connection screen where Zapya on your iPhone will search all available devices in the same network. Run Zapya app on both your iOS and Android devices. Connect iPhone and Android via Wi-FiĬonnect both mobile phones to the same Wi-Fi network. There are two easy ways to connect your iPhone to Android and share files between them: Wi-Fi and hotspot. You can download this free file transfer app here before we get started.

In this quick guide, we will show you how to connect iPhone with Android via Wi-Fi or hotspot and transfer files between them wirelessly using the free file sharing app. It makes use of your Wi-Fi tethering or hotspot feature to connect to other phones, and share files between them wirelessly. Zapya is a free tool for wirelessly file sharing across different platforms and devices like Android, iPhone, iPad, Windows Phone, PC, and Mac computers.
